Tuning Ball is one of Kum Haehyun's Special Attacks, first appearing in Guilty Gear Xrd -Revelator-.

Overview[]

Haehyun blows out a sphere that travels in a straight line. The Slash version takes the form of a small blue & black ball that travels relatively quick. The Heavy Slash has Haehyun charge and mould a bigger ball before releasing it - this time, colored orange and travels slower, but hits up to 3 times.

While it's still moving, the Tuning Ball can change its direction by holding Left or Right while it's still moving. The Slash version will last up to 3 seconds without hitting anything, while the Heavy Slash version lasts only 2 seconds.

Celestial Tuning Ball (神弓・調伝丸, Shinkyū: Chōdengan?, lit. Divine Bow: Tuning Sphere)

The Overdrive version, Celestial Tuning Ball, creates an even bigger blue ball with intricate designs. Unlike the regular Tuning Ball, Celestial Tuning Ball can move in any direction for up to 4 seconds, and deal a maximum of 5 hits.

Trivia[]

  • The way Haehyun charges the Heavy Slash Tuning Ball is reminiscent of the way Dragon Ball's Yamcha charges his Spirit Ball technique, which can also move in any which direction.
